Action Steps
  1. Investigate alternative solutions to paying ransoms, such as restoring from backups or using decryption tools
  2. Implement robust security measures, including regular software updates and employee training, to prevent ransomware attacks
  3. Develop a comprehensive incident response plan to quickly respond to and contain ransomware attacks
  4. Collaborate with law enforcement and cybersecurity experts to stay informed about emerging threats and best practices
  5. Conduct regular security audits to identify and address vulnerabilities in your organization's systems
